A timely rescue operation by Motorway Police averted a major disaster as back tyres of a Mazda truck suddenly caught fire on M-2 Motorway near Khanqah Dogran.
Motorway Police Central Region spokesman Syed Imran Ahmad said that soon after receiving the report, Motorway Polie rushed to the spot and started a rescue operation to bring the fire under control by using fire extinguishing tools available in government vehicles before the arrival of the fire brigade team.
The timely and professional action of the Motorway Police prevented a major accident and saved precious lives and property. The truck driver and all the people who were present at the site lauded the professionalism shown by the Motorway Police to bring the fire under control.
